    I understand that Mrs. ***** needed assistance with her rent. As a small agency, we receive over 600 calls a month for aid, and unfortunately, we cannot assist everyone. Mrs. ***** has also filed a complaint with San Bernardino County. Even though our remaining funds are not county-issued,we have tried to address her concerns.
    First and foremost, our application process is determined by our funder. We understand that it may seem lengthy and complex, and we apologize for any inconvenience. We strive to assist as many callers as possible at Victor Valley Family Resource. However, not every call will meet the necessary criteria. We work diligently to help as many people as possible with our limited available funds. When our funds are depleted, we make every effort to refer to other agencies that may be able to assist.
    In reviewing applicant files, we review for the following criteria:
    if the applicants meet income qualifications
    Was enough income within the documentation to pay the requested assistance
    If there was, were there extenuating circumstances that prevented the applicant from paying the requested assistance
    Can housing be sustained with the amount of assistance requested
    If not, are there recommendations that can be made
    Is there enough funding available to meet the request
    After reviewing Mrs. ****** application, it was determined that the rent could have been paid. She had not paid rent or utilities for several months.
